  • The industrial age routine of a 9-5 fits-all working system might finally be being dismantled, but what will replace it, and will it work for you? This thoughtful and practical book sketches out new approaches to individualized working styles which prioritize wellbeing, productivity and fairness. The authors, Lizzie and Alex, are at the forefront of business thinking in this area, having worked with companies such as Unilever, Amazon, and AIA and been featured in the FT, Times, Telegraph, Stylist, Marie Claire, Metro and The Guardian, among others. If you are an ambitious Gen Z millennial at the start of a career, looking for a job which works with your ethical framework, an experienced professional moving into a leadership role, or a business owner, CEO, manager or HR professional, this book provides a vital contemporary overview of what will work best in a business world which is newly flexible, imaginative, neurodiverse and accountable. It will help you create a way of working which frees your best people, liberates your potential and allow you to stand out and do your best work how suits you best. Written by the inventors of the term workstyle, this book will relieve you of your ancestors' conditioning, inspire you to create a workstyle for yourself, and enable you to take part in the most significant change to working practices since 1817. By giving you the complete freedom to identify and pursue a way of working which fits around the unique nature of your lifestyle, you can be well, work better and do good. "This will turn your view of work and life UPSIDE DOWN" Jon Younger, FORBES
